The enthusiasm for “Good Science” in Japan
A report on the Metascience Meetup 2026 in Tokyo
by Rei Nouchi (Research Institute for Higher Education, Hiroshima University) and Noel Kikuchi (National Graduate Institute for Public Studies)
The Metascience Meetup 2026 was held over two days, 14–15 March 2026, at the National Museum of Emerging Science and Innovation in Tokyo. The event was organised by members of the Metascience Research Group—an assembly of individuals from research institutions, government and funding agencies, and private think tanks who have come together across institutional boundaries to improve the scientific enterprise—along with additional volunteers who share the same mission. The meeting was co-organised by Hiroshima University’s Research Institute for Higher Education / Center for Co‑creative Sciences, and Osaka University’s Center on Ethical, Legal and Social Issues / Center for Infectious Disease Education and Research / EIPM Center).
The meeting was motivated by the growing global attention to metascience. Since 2019, the international Metascience Conference has been held biennially, and its most recent iteration in June–July 2025 reportedly drew more than 800 participants worldwide. Feeling the intensity and diversity of ideas flowing in from abroad, the Meetup 2026 organisers hoped to bring that momentum to Japan, reinterpret it within local contexts, and create a venue where the wide range of potential stakeholders in Japanese metascience could gather for open discussion.
A defining feature of this event was its insistence on strictly in-person participation, despite the prevalence of online and hybrid formats today (with only one key speaker joining remotely). By prioritizing candid, face-to-face conversations and the “chemical reactions” that arise from unexpected encounters, the event drew about 80 participants each day and fostered a uniquely dense atmosphere in which metascience was treated as an essential dimension of scientific practice.
The meeting was advertised. Publicity was shared through mailing lists from academic societies (including philosophy of science and STS), university websites, social media, and word of mouth. Pre-registration data showed that while most attendees were researchers, a wide range of non-research stakeholders also took part.
This diversity reflects the expanding interest in metascience in Japan—an expansion fueled not least by expectations surrounding Japan’s 7th Science, Technology, and Innovation Basic Plan, which is launching this year. The plan explicitly states the need to incorporate insights from metascience and the science of science to continually reassess the effectiveness of science as a form of human intellectual activity, as well as the frameworks used to evaluate research. Many anticipate that this will translate into concrete policy initiatives.
The program started with the opening address titled “SEIZE THE META-MOMENT! Japan in a changing global landscape for the science of science itself” by Prof. James Wilsdon at RoRI / UCL, and featured two additional keynote lectures and five sessions: Lightning Talks; Trends in Metascience in Japan and Abroad; Science of Science; AI for Science and Metascience; and Open Science. These themes were chosen to provide newcomers with an accessible overview of internationally relevant debates in the field. At the same time, the content went beyond quantitative analyses: researchers specialising in philosophy of science and ethics added new layers of insight, giving the event a distinctive character rather than simply replicating overseas discussions.
Japan has few opportunities for researchers, government officials, funding agencies, and private-sector support organisations to openly exchange views across institutional lines, largely because of potential conflicts of interest. Yet at this meeting, participants spoke candidly about their concerns without slipping into unproductive criticism or superficial praise. This was due in part to the personalities and communication skills of the speakers, but more fundamentally, it reflected a shared expectation of what metascience can contribute to science.
A key theme running through all discussions was how to integrate “diversity” into the systems that support scientific activity—diversity in reproducibility, diversity in evaluation practices, diversity in funding mechanisms, and more. Under the broad umbrella of metascience, these diverse perspectives naturally lead to multiple viewpoints rather than a single conclusion. If the metascience community has a unifying goal—taken to its conceptual limit—it is the advancement of good science. But bringing this ideal closer to practical implementation requires multiple models and frameworks. Participants reflected on how individual conceptions of “good science,” shifting between the particular and the universal, might contribute to the optimization of the scientific community.
In this way, the two-day meeting wove together discussions on the diversification of science and the value frameworks that underpin it—a rich exploration of what “good science” can be, and how we might collectively strive toward it.
